Export data to adobe non interactive form

Hello,
I would like to fill a non interactive adobe form with seized data in visual composer.
How I can do that please ?

Tony-
I have not worked with Adobe Forms so I am not sure if this is feasible. If I had to populate a Web Dynpro form with data from a VC form I would have an action which would invoke the URL of the Web Dynpro application. This URL would have appended to it the field name and values as entered in the VC form. In the Web Dynpro component I would retrieve all the parameter values being passed through the URL and then set these values into the context. If the context is bound to a form, the data will automatically be displayed.

    Yeah I know changing the form properties will solve my problem, but since i'm developing a training for Interactive Forms in Web Dynpro Java, I wanted to figure out why the (static / non-interactive) combination didn't work, turned out to be a template problem, which i still didn't figure out, except the fact that having flowed content on your template is not the problem.
    My ideas about your question:
    When we have the layout of an Interactive Form, its clear if it's meant to be static or dynamic, we don't know however, if it's interactive or non-interactive.
    I don't think we can judge a layout to have an Interactive or non-interactive purpose, can depend on the situation in which the same form is shown/used:
    - One moment it can be interactive, e.g. user is filling in the form, can enter data etc.
    - Next moment it can be non-interactive, e.g. form is shown to another user.
    So it's more the scenario/situation that determines if the form is interactive or non-interactive.

    HI
    You cannot just simply convert one string to xstring and then set it in pdfsource to get the pdf.
    what is required is little bit lengthy than wht you are doing right now.
    you need to use adobe live cycle designer to design the form first and bound the layout UIs there to the context and then
    when the pdf wll be generated it will have the data.
    1. Go to transaction SFP ad create one interface there with some parameter say data.
    2. create a form based on this interface.
    3. in the template source property of the UI give the form you have created it will automatically create context for the import
    parameter that you have given in the interface.
    4. now you need to double click on the interactive form UI to open Adobe live cycle designer to design the layout of the form to
      display the data that you will get form the import parameter.
    5. pass the required data to the context which is created as the import parameter
    these are the steps required to create a PDF form having the data passed by you from the programm dynamically.

    How do we use scripting in Live Cycle Designer to render a non-interactive pdf. Data is populating the form using xml. Thanks and help will be appreciated

    Couple of issues that you should know before proceeding.
    1. To communicate with a web service from the form using Reader you will need to Reader Extend the form using Reader Extensions Server and not Acrobat. Acrobat does not turn that right on. Note that if you intend to use Acrobat this is not an issue.
    2. There is no means of getting the PDF form while it is running into the context of a SOAP message. There is no programmatic way to put the PDF into the payload from the form. I can get the data but not the form.
    3. Once the data is populated into the form we could change all of the fields to Read Only ...thereby achieving the flattening that you require.
    4. The web service will not be able to save or print locally through the client. The client will have to do that . The client being Reader or Acrobat.
